You want to start a blog. But you’re stuck on what to write about, and you don’t want to waste your money picking the wrong niche.
Here are 50 beginner-friendly blog niche ideas you can start today in Nigeria, even on a budget as small as ₦500.
Personal & Lifestyle

1) Student Life in Nigeria
Write about campus experiences, hostel survival, and making the most of university life. Students always search for relatable content from someone who truly gets their daily struggles.
Monetise with: AdSense, student product sponsorships
2) Personal Finance for Beginners
Help everyday Nigerians manage their money, save smarter, and avoid unnecessary debt. Money problems are universal, and that makes this niche one of the most searched topics online.
Monetise with: Fintech affiliate programs, sponsored posts
3) Minimalist Living
Write about owning less, spending less, and living more intentionally. Minimalism is picking up fast among young Nigerians who want to simplify their lives and reduce stress.
Monetise with: AdSense, brand partnerships
4) Daily Routines & Productivity
Share morning routines, time management strategies, and habit-building tips readers can use immediately. Productivity content attracts driven readers who want to do more in less time.
Monetise with: Digital product sales, course affiliates
5) Relationships & Self-Improvement
Cover dating advice, communication tips, and personal growth strategies. This niche builds intensely loyal audiences who return regularly for guidance they can trust.
Monetise with: AdSense, book affiliates, sponsored posts
Money & Side Hustles

6) Online Side Hustles in Nigeria
Teach Nigerians how to earn extra income online. With rising costs, this is one of the most searched topics in the country, and it shows absolutely no signs of slowing down.
Monetise with: Course affiliates, sponsored posts
7) Freelancing for Beginners
Help beginners land their first client on Fiverr, Upwork, or LinkedIn. Many Nigerians want to freelance but feel lost about where and how to begin.
Monetise with: Platform affiliate links, coaching services
8) Affiliate Marketing
Teach readers how to earn commissions by promoting other people’s products online. This niche is perfect for beginners who want to build passive income streams from day one.
Monetise with: Your own affiliate links, digital courses
9) Passive Income Ideas
Write about ways to make money while you sleep, from digital downloads to small investments. Passive income content attracts hungry readers who are ready to take action fast.
Monetise with: Digital product sales, AdSense
10) Making Money with AI Tools
Show Nigerians how to use tools like ChatGPT to earn real money online. It is one of the fastest-growing search topics in 2026, and the space is still wide open.
Monetise with: Tool affiliate programs, online courses
Tech & Digital

11) Blogging Tutorials
Teach people how to start, grow, and earn from a blog. This is a brilliant niche because you practise exactly what you teach, and readers trust that.
Monetise with: Hosting affiliates (like Truehost), course sales
12) Website Creation (No-Code)
Show beginners how to build websites without writing a single line of code. The demand for this is enormous among Nigerian entrepreneurs who want an online presence fast.
Monetise with: Tool affiliates, freelance services
13) Smartphone Tips & Tricks
Help Nigerians get more value from their Android and iPhone devices every day. Practical smartphone tips attract thousands of monthly searches from everyday phone users.
Monetise with: AdSense, gadget affiliate links
14) AI Tools for Beginners
Break down complex AI tools into simple guides that anyone can follow and apply. This niche is growing fast, and the competition in Nigeria is still surprisingly low.
Monetise with: Tool affiliates, digital guides
15) Social Media Growth
Teach readers how to grow on Instagram, TikTok, or X (Twitter). Brands pay serious money to sponsor blogs that help people build audiences online.
Monetise with: Brand sponsorships, digital courses
Education & Career
16) CV Writing Tips
Help job seekers write CVs that actually get noticed by Nigerian employers. Fresh graduates search for this content in massive numbers every single month.
Monetise with: CV writing service, sponsored job platforms
17) Job Hunting in Nigeria
Share practical advice for finding work in a tough Nigerian job market. Thousands of young Nigerians search for actionable job-hunting tips every day.
Monetise with: AdSense, sponsored job boards
18) Interview Preparation
Teach readers how to walk into any interview feeling confident and ready. Practical tips, mock questions, and mindset advice make this niche deeply helpful.
Monetise with: Interview coaching, digital guides
19) Scholarships & Study Abroad
Share fully-funded scholarship opportunities and step-by-step application guides. This niche gets incredible traffic because the demand among Nigerian students is enormous.
Monetise with: AdSense, consulting services
20) Online Courses & Skills
Review and recommend online courses on Coursera, Udemy, and YouTube. Help readers decide which skills to learn in 2026, and earn commissions when they sign up.
Monetise with: Course affiliate commissions
Business & Entrepreneurship
21) Small Business Ideas
Write about low-cost business ideas Nigerians can start with little capital. Many people want to be their own boss but genuinely have no idea where to begin.
Monetise with: AdSense, business tools, and affiliates
22) Importation Business
Break down how to source and sell goods from China and other countries. It remains one of the most searched business topics in Nigeria year after year.
Monetise with: Paid guides, consulting, sponsored posts
23) Dropshipping in Nigeria
Explain how to sell products online without ever holding stock. Dropshipping content attracts aspiring entrepreneurs who want a low-risk way to start.
Monetise with: Course affiliates, digital product sales
24) Startup Tips
Share honest lessons, practical resources, and real advice for people building their first business. Founders constantly search for guidance they can read and act on immediately.
Monetise with: Business tool affiliates, consulting
25) Branding for Beginners
Help small Nigerian business owners build a recognizable brand on a tight budget. Strong visual identity and messaging make this niche both creative and highly practical.
Monetise with: Design tool affiliates, freelance service
Health & Wellness

26) Fitness at Home
Share workout routines that require zero gym membership and zero expensive equipment. With the cost of living rising, home fitness content is more popular across Nigeria than ever.
Monetise with: Fitness product affiliates, digital workout plans
27) Mental Health Awareness
Break the stigma around mental health in Nigeria through honest, compassionate content. This is an underserved niche with a passionate and rapidly growing audience.
Monetise with: AdSense, book affiliates, wellness brand partnerships
28) Healthy Eating on a Budget
Show readers how to prepare nutritious meals without spending a fortune. Budget meal prep content connects deeply with young Nigerians managing tight household expenses.
Monetise with: Food brand sponsorships, recipe digital guides
29) Weight Loss Journeys
Document real weight loss stories or share research-backed, easy-to-follow tips. Personal transformation content earns strong engagement and builds very loyal readers.
Monetise with: Supplement affiliates, coaching programs
30) Self-Care Routines
Write about skincare, rest, and habits that protect both mental and physical well-being. Self-care blogs attract a young, engaged audience that beauty and wellness brands actively seek.
Monetise with: Beauty brand partnerships, AdSense
Entertainment & Pop Culture
31) Nigerian Music Trends
Cover the latest Afrobeats, Amapiano, and street-pop releases from Nigeria and across Africa. Music is consistently one of the highest-traffic niches for Nigerian blogs.
Monetise with: AdSense, event sponsorships
32) Movie & Series Reviews
Review the latest Netflix, Prime Video, and Nollywood releases your audience is already watching. Entertainment review blogs are quick to write, easy to grow, and simple to monetize.
Monetise with: AdSense, streaming affiliate links
33) Celebrity News
Cover the stories, achievements, and moments of Nigerian and international celebrities. Celebrity blogs attract massive daily traffic, especially when shared on social media.
Monetise with: AdSense, sponsored entertainment posts.
34) TikTok Trends
Break down viral TikTok videos, sounds, and challenges for your readers. This niche is fast-moving, fresh, and pulls in younger Nigerian readers at scale.
Monetise with: AdSense, brand sponsorships
35) Viral Content Analysis
Explain why certain content goes viral and what drives people to share it online. This niche works for both general readers and aspiring content creators looking for an edge.
Monetise with: AdSense, digital marketing course affiliates
Hyper-Local Niches
36) Living in Lagos
Write guides about food, transport, apartments, events, and survival tips for life in Lagos. Hyper-local content ranks fast in search engines because competition is still very low.
Monetise with: Local business sponsorships, AdSense
37) Living in Abuja
Cover the Abuja lifestyle, restaurants, nightlife, apartments, and social scenes. This audience tends to be middle-class and very attractive to local and national advertisers.
Monetise with: Sponsored local business features, AdSense
38) Local Food Reviews
Visit and review local restaurants, pepper soup joints, suya spots, and chop houses.
Food review blogs build strong community followings quickly because readers love sharing recommendations.
Monetise with: Restaurant sponsorships, AdSense
39) Events & Hangout Spots
Share the best concerts, markets, and hangout locations in your city every week. People always search for things to do nearby, and you become their trusted guide.
Monetise with: Event ticket affiliates, venue sponsorships
40) Nigerian Street Culture
Document the fashion, slang, music, and trends born on Nigerian streets. This niche has a passionate, underserved audience and almost zero serious competition.
Monetise with: Brand partnerships, AdSense
Micro-Niches (Easy to Rank)
41) Budget Travel in Nigeria
Show readers how to explore Nigeria’s cities, beaches, and landmarks without spending much. Budget travel content ranks well because competition is still low and interest is rising fast.
Monetise with: Hotel affiliates, AdSense
42) Parenting Tips for Young Families
Help Nigerian parents navigate raising children in today’s challenging world. Young parents are deeply engaged readers who trust consistent, warm, and practical bloggers.
Monetise with: Baby product affiliates, AdSense
43) Tech for Students
Recommend apps, tools, and devices that help students study faster and smarter. This niche connects strongly with Nigeria’s massive and ever-growing student population.
Monetise with: App affiliates, sponsored product reviews
44) Fashion on a Budget
Help readers look their very best without spending much money at all. Budget fashion is a high-traffic search category among young Nigerian women in particular.
Monetise with: Fashion affiliate programs, brand sponsorships
45) Skincare for Dark Skin
Share product reviews, daily routines, and tips designed for melanin-rich skin. It is a growing, passionate niche where reader loyalty is exceptionally strong.
Monetize with: Skincare brand affiliates, sponsored reviews
Beginner-Friendly Evergreen Niches
46) How-To Guides (General Tutorials)
Write clear, step-by-step guides on everyday tasks your readers are already searching for. How-to content ranks well in search engines and stays relevant for years after you publish it.
Monetise with: AdSense, digital guide sales
47) Product Reviews (Budget Items)
Review affordable products Nigerians already buy and trust. Honest reviews build deep trust with readers and generate consistent affiliate income over time.
Monetize with: Affiliate marketing commissions
48) Comparison Blogs
Compare two similar products, services, or platforms and help readers decide which is better. Comparison content attracts buyers who are close to making a decision, they convert very well.
Monetize with: Affiliate commissions from both options
49) Resource & Tools Blogs
Curate the best apps, websites, and tools for a specific audience and explain why each one matters. Readers bookmark resource blogs and share them widely across social media platforms.
Monetise with: Tool affiliates, AdSense
50) Case Studies & Experiments
Document exactly what you tried, what worked, and what taught you a hard lesson. Case study content is among the most trusted online because it is built entirely on real experience.
Monetise with: AdSense, coaching, course sales
